An air pollution specialist is a professional who specializes in studying and analyzing the quality of air in a specific area. They are responsible for monitoring and assessing the levels of pollutants present in the atmosphere, identifying potential sources of pollution, and developing strategies to mitigate and control air pollution. These specialists conduct field investigations, collect air samples, and use various instruments and technologies to measure and analyze air quality data. They also collaborate with government agencies, industries, and communities to develop and implement effective air pollution control measures and regulations. Additionally, they may provide expert advice and guidance on environmental impact assessments, pollution prevention, and sustainable development practices.

Air Pollution Specialist salary in Latvia
Average Yearly Salary of Air Pollution Specialist in Latvia is approximately 29,000 EUR (29,017 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
